Abstract

Abstract This paper deals with the evaluation of certain integral transforms involving the product of certain Appell and Bessel functions with a weight e - γ t 2 {e^{-\gamma t^{2}}} . The transformations of these integrals are evaluated in terms of the Appell, Kampé de Fériet and the triple hypergeometric functions. As an application, we studied propagation of generalized Humbert–Gaussian beams (GHGBs) and hypergeometric-Gaussian beams (HyGGBs) in turbulent atmosphere and through an ABCD paraxial optical system. The evaluation of these integral transforms has initiated a great interest in mathematical physics and its applications to laser physics and linear or non-linear optics.
